How does a project engineer project manager balance technical tasks with leadership responsibilities on a project?

Project Engineer Project Managers are often required to oversee both the technical execution and overall coordination of a project. This means they must allocate time for hands-on engineering tasks, such as reviewing designs or resolving technical issues, while also managing schedules, budgets, and communication with stakeholders. Effective candidates use strong organizational skills and delegation, relying on their team’s expertise for technical details while focusing on big-picture management and client relations. Balancing these aspects is crucial for ensuring project success within scope, time, and cost constraints.

Who gets paid more, a project manager or a project engineer?

Typically, a project manager earns higher salaries than a project engineer because they have greater responsibilities, oversee multiple projects, and require more experience and leadership skills. Project managers often have certifications like PMP and manage budgets, schedules, and teams, which contribute to their higher compensation.

What is a project engineer project manager?

A Project Engineer Project Manager is a professional who combines technical engineering expertise with project management skills to oversee and deliver engineering projects. They are responsible for planning, coordinating, and executing projects from conception through completion, ensuring they meet quality, budget, and timeline requirements. This role involves collaborating with engineers, contractors, and stakeholders, as well as managing resources, schedules, and risks. Project Engineer Project Managers act as a bridge between technical teams and management, ensuring that project objectives align with organizational go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a project engineer project man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Project Engineer Project Manager, you need a solid background in engineering principles, project management methodologies, and a relevant degree, often supported by certifications like PMP or PE. Familiarity with project management software (such as MS Project or Primavera), CAD tools, and budgeting systems is typ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ills are essential for effectively managing teams and stakeholders. These skills ensure projects are delivered on time, within scope, and meet quality and safety standards.
